Order Striking Appendix - Non-Compliance With R. 9.220 ~ ORDERED that appellant's appendix to the initial brief is stricken as not in compliance with Florida Rule of Appellate Procedure 9.220(c), which was amended effective October 1, 2017, in that it was not properly indexed and consecutively paginated, beginning with the cover sheet as page 1, was not fully text searchable, was not paginated so that the page numbers displayed by the PDF reader exactly match the pagination of the index, and contains bookmarks which are not in compliance with Rule 9.220(c)(3). An amended appendix in compliance with Rule 9.220(c) shall be filed within two (2) days from the date of this order.

Aplnt to Obtain Final Order-Dobrick/BCH ~ It appearing that the order to which the Notice of Appeal is directed is a non–appealable, non–final order, appellant(s) shall have thirty (30) days from the date of this order to obtain a final order and to file a copy in this court. Failure to do so will result in sua sponte dismissal of the appeal. Dobrick v. Discovery Cruises, Inc., 581 So. 2d 645 (Fla. 4th DCA 1991); see also Rust v. Brown, 13 So. 3d 1105, 1107 (Fla. 4th DCA 2009) ("An order merely granting a motion for summary judgment is not a final order because it does not enter judgment for or against a party."). ORDERED that the trial court is specifically authorized, pursuant to Florida Rule of Appellate Procedure 9.600(b), upon appropriate application, to enter a final order in these proceedings.
